The rule of thumb when using either...or and neither...nor is that the noun or pronoun closest to the verb determines what form it should take. Either and neither used on their own can also mean 'one or the other', 'whichever of the two' / 'not this one and not the other one', or 'not one of the two': There are boats on either side of the river. 7.
